- [ ] Rounding check: before we sign anything, confirm the Quillbank conversion module rounds half-even, not half-up. Last ceremony we caught a one-cent drift on the ledger replay and had to redo the whole witness session. Run the drift script, get two reviewers to initial the output, then unlock the ceremony vault — the passphrase for it is recorded directly below.

unlock words, hahip-baduf: holwyn-istath-julvan

All high-volume tables in the Ledgerline warehouse are partitioned by calendar month on the event timestamp column. New partitions are created automatically three days before month start by the Partwright job. Queries should always include a timestamp filter so the planner can prune partitions; full scans are blocked in production. Partitions older than 18 months are detached and archived to cold storage. The full partition naming convention and retention schedule are documented on the internal wiki page here.

operations page: https://jenkins.zemvarcloud.local/job/merge_requests/repo/build/73930b4b30f0a8ed

## Deploying the Gatewick Proctor Queue

Deploys are pretty painless: push to main, wait for the pipeline, then watch the queue drain dashboard for five minutes. If candidates pile up mid-exam, roll back first and ask questions later — the queue replays safely. Everything the workers care about lives in one config block, shown here for reference.

settings of bafof-yagef:
JOROX_PIN=8740
JOROX_TENANT=pelox
JOROX_METRICS_HOST=metrics.jorox.qorvelworks.internal
JOROX_SEAL=seal_c78f63c1
JOROX_STANDBY_TEAM=norax

## Formula sandbox tuning

User-supplied formulas in Gridmoor execute inside a restricted interpreter with hard ceilings on time, memory, and call depth. Reviewers should confirm any change to these ceilings is justified in the PR description, since raising them widens the abuse surface. Defaults were chosen from production traces. The current limits are as follows.

limits module of tafog-fawip:
WEIGHTS = {
    "julix": 57,
    "lamys": 992,
    "kasvan": 209,
    "quenok": 750,
    "alddor": 259,
    "oliath": 1009,
    "wenix": 815,
}